MD6002 Datasheet. Specs and Replacement
Type Designator: MD6002 📄📄
Material of Transistor: Si
Polarity: p*n
Absolute Maximum Ratings
Maximum Collector Power Dissipation (Pc): 0.4 W
Maximum Collector-Base Voltage |Vcb|: 80 V
Maximum Collector-Emitter Voltage |Vce|: 30 V
Maximum Emitter-Base Voltage |Veb|: 5 V
Maximum Collector Current |Ic max|: 0.5 A
Max. Operating Junction Temperature (Tj): 200 °C
Electrical Characteristics
Transition Frequency (ft): 170 MHz
Collector Capacitance (Cc): 5.6 pF
Forward Current Transfer Ratio (hFE), MIN: 100
Package: TO77
